3. Canadian Anti-Money Laundering Law And Your Privacy

Matador is what FINTRAC, the part of the Canadian government that undertakes financial surveillance and oversees many aspects of Canada’s anti-money laundering/anti-terrorist financing system, describes as “a dealer in precious metals and precious stones” (DPMS). As a DPMS, Matador is required to maintain certain records and collect identity information. 

Matador at all times follows the law, and there are privacy implications of these rules. In addition to mandatory reporting as required under the principal federal legislation (the Proceeds of Crime (Money Laundering) and Terrorist Financing Act and its regulations), Matador may also disclose information related to potential criminal activities to its partners, including financial institutions, service providers, and professional advisors. Matador may also file suspicious activities reports (which it may not be strictly required to file) with government agencies (i.e. FINTRAC) if it believes that it may be in the best interests of Matador, the integrity of the Canadian financial system, or for the protection of a Matador user.
